How To Select Saint Cloud a Home Warranty Plan for Your Needs

Choosing a home warranty in Florida shouldn't be complicated, but you may be surprised to learn just how many options there are. While most plans are similar, coverages may vary as well as costs. Feel free to take the time you need to make sure you choose the best plan for your needs.

Once you pick a home warranty company and plan in Saint Cloud, your coverage doesn't start right away. You'll need to have an inspection performed on your covered equipment and appliances before your warranty can go into effect. This appointment will be arranged through the home warranty company and should be provided at no cost to you. After the inspection, your warranty period can begin.

Who Should Buy A Home Warranty

Not everyone needs a home warranty in Florida. If you live in a home that is a few years old, you may be considering purchasing a home warranty to take effect when the manufacturer's warranty expires. Or, if you just bought an older home, a home warranty may be a good idea if it also came with older systems and you don't know their maintenance history. Likewise, if your home came with a home warranty and that is expiring, you may want to purchase your own to continue your coverage.

If you are confident in your abilities to pay out-of-pocket for unexpected repairs, you may not need a home warranty in Saint Cloud. Some major repairs can cost several thousand dollars, so you'll want to consider the risks and investment when considering purchasing a home warranty.

What Does A Home Warranty Cover?

When you are choosing a home warranty in Florida it's important to understand what's covered and what isn't under your warranty plan. On a basic level, a home warranty covers your home's plumbing, electrical, and HVAC systems as well as major appliances like your refrigerator, water heater, and dishwasher. If you have a dehumidifier, water softener, or other type of non-standard appliance that can be covered, too.

A home warranty in Saint Cloud is not home insurance and does not cover household repairs or damage to your home. It also won't cover damage due to negligence. You do have the option to customize your plan to include all or some of the appliances in your home, so you only pay for what you need covered.

Who Is Eligible For A Home Warranty

Anyone who owns a home may be eligible for a home warranty in Florida, including rental property owners. Renters should not need a home warranty, as any repairs should be handled by their landlord. Those already covered by a warranty plan need not worry, as well as those who bought a new house and are covered by a builder's warranty.

A home warranty in Saint Cloud is ideal for homeowners with expiring warranty coverage, or whose home and appliances are a few years old. Even newer homes can have systems fail or appliances break, though older homes are more likely to have issues with repairs. Be sure to consider the age of your home's systems, the maintenance history, as well as the repair history when deciding whether you should get a home warranty.

Understanding Home Warranty Coverage

A home warranty in Florida is a supplemental warranty plan that provides an extra layer of protection for your appliances and home systems such as your HVAC or plumbing systems. A home warranty is not insurance and doesn't cover damage to your appliances. It does cover unexpected repairs due to a part failure or other malfunction, and it's available to cover older appliances or systems that may be more apt to needing repairs.

Similar to a manufacturer's warranty, a home warranty in Saint Cloud protects your home appliances and systems from defects and malfunctions. A manufacturer's warranty applies to a limited time - typically one to three years - and anything that happens outside that timeframe is no longer the manufacturer's responsibility. A home warranty can cover the gap and ensure repairs for your appliances are covered well after the initial warranty period.
